Huge nationwide plans had been drawn up to mark the anniversary of Victory in Europe day at the end of World War Two – but they have had to be scrapped because of the coronavirus lockdown.
Now people across the country are being urged to host a ‘stay at home street party’ on May 8 – and to celebrate the date with a socially distanced party!

Hide AdOrganisers want people to decorate their home in red, white and blue – and enjoy a picnic in their front garden.
The idea is that neighbours in streets across Britain will come out to drape their homes in flags and bunting – and then enjoy the festivities, while observing Government gudielines on social distancing and staying at 2m apart from others and not gathering in groups.
